Rescue of Erdan

With the death of the Crimson Acolyte, the power controlling the remaining undead is gone, and they fall to motionless mounds of flesh and bone.

As Leenia helps the ancient elf to a sitting position, he introduces himself. "Thank you so much for coming to my aid, I am Erdan, former and I guess once again, High Priest of the Citadel, Keeper of the Seasons, and one of the oldest elves you are likely to meet."

"As you probably know, 50 years go, this island was invaded. When I saw the fall was imminent, I had to make the decision to stay or leave. Like everyone else, I had decided to leave, and then I learned of the heinous acts of this one," kicking the corpse of the Crimson Acolyte. "I could not allow him to continue his vile work, and for 50 or so years, we have fought each other to a standstill. I have done my best to stop him from desecrating those who have been preserved here, but have failed on several accounts. That is behind us, I have done my best to limit his activities and succeeded.”

“Then a couple days ago, the Cult of the Infernal Fang arrived on the island. They went looking for the Seal of the Seasons. It had been hanging at the top of the cathedral for centuries, however, I had it removed and hidden down here with me before the island fell. It is a powerful artifact, but also huge, it took 3 men almost a day to move it down here. For 50 years I kept it hidden and safe. Then Damakos arrived. He truly is a terrifying being. He knew exactly where to find me and the Seal. Whoever his patron is, it has truly blessed him with great power. I was no match for the Cult and they took the Seal with little challenge. He turned me over to this accursed monster,” kicking the body again. “And he began the ritual you interrupted on me. Had he succeeded, he would have ripped my soul from this body. What I would have become, I do not know and wish not to consider.”

“Back to Damakos, he ordered three of his men to begin transporting the Seal to their boat. He and the rest would be waiting for them there. Because of the magic placed on the Seal, moving it away from the Citadel is extremely difficult unless you are the Keeper of the Seasons. As such, their progress has been slow and I believe you can catch them and retrieve the Seal.”

At this point, Erdan gets off the table and asks the party to follow him. He leads them down a couple corridors into an area that acts as a drain for the catacombs. He unlocks and removes one of the grates and enters a small tunnel. A minute later he returns with a potion and scroll. “Everyone take a sip of this potion, it will revitalize you and give you the endurance to catch the foul spawn that are transporting the Seal. Take this wizard,” handing the scroll to Kuppies,” it is an enhanced Floating Disk ritual that will allow the Seal to be returned here with little physical effort on the part of all of you. Now quickly, be on your way, I will be awaiting your return and will answer all of your questions then. One more thing, among the Cult is one known as Melech, if you encounter him, do not kill him. While Damakos treats him as a lieutenant, I do not believe his heart is filled with the darkness the rest of the Cult possess.”

The benefits of the potion are complete restoration of hit points, daily powers, and healing surges. It will also allow you to travel quickly enough and without rest so that you can catch the members of the Cult that are transporting the Seal.
